Investing in Cultural and Artistic Programming for Forum des Jeunes Ambassadeurs de la Francophonie des Ameriques

Minister Glover announces funding for the Societe franco-manitobaine


WINNIPEG, MANITOBA--(Marketwired - June 24, 2014) - Department of Canadian Heritage

The Government of Canada is providing $19,967 in funding for the Société franco-manitobaine in support of the coordination of artistic and cultural activities at the Forum des jeunes ambassadeurs de la francophonie des Amériques. Forum participants, including the facilitators, speakers and organizers, will have an opportunity to enjoy music, improvisation and films. Manitoba's Francophones and Francophiles will also be invited to take part in these activities to meet and talk with the young ambassadors.

The Honourable Shelly Glover, Minister of Canadian Heritage and Official Languages, made the announcement today at the Forum's opening ceremony. The Government of Canada is providing funding through the Community Life component of the Development of Official-Language Communities Program.

Quick facts

  • The Société franco-manitobaine, in partnership with the Université de Saint-Boniface, is host of the Forum des jeunes ambassadeurs de la francophonie des Amériques 2014, being held in St. Boniface, Manitoba, from June 23 to 30.
  • An initiative of the Centre de la francophonie des Amériques, the forum is for Francophones of the Americas aged 18 to 35.
  • The forum participants come from Canada, the United States, the Caribbean and Latin America.
